The access to the Boarding area Modules is through the security checkpoints located independently at levels 2 and 4 in the Departures hall.

These areas provide access to their respective Boarding gates, with passport checkpoint depending on the destination.. You can find more information in the following tabs on this page, or in the Check in and Boarding gates section. The airport has a total of 86 numbered Boarding gates 69 physical, some with double or triple numeration throughout the four Boarding Modules, and a total of 25 fingers or jet bridges. The airport has a single Arrivals hall located in the Passenger Terminal, regardless of the module to which the flight arrives.

Arrivals hall: level 0. Domestic and international flight Arrivals. The airport has a single baggage claim area located in the Passenger Terminal, regardless of the Module to which the flight arrives. Level 0, Exclusive area for passengers. Arrivals area has passport checkpoint depending on the flight origin. Customs: level 0, baggage claim area. Lost luggage : level 0 and 2, Arrivals hall.
